现在我正在使用SyncFramework 2.1来同步两个数据库(几乎3GB的数据),这个过程就是减速的方法。 有时我得到一个异常,指示“超时或远程数据库没有响应”。 我最近发现,在SelectionChanges活动期间,更改存储在内存中,应用程序开始占用大量内存,有时我会得到异常:
The process was terminated due to an unhandled exception. Exception Info: System.OutOfMemoryException
那么,有谁知道我做错了什么? Sync Framework中的内存问题是正常的吗?
任何帮助将不胜感激,
由于
答案 0 :(得分:0)
您正在同步哪些数据库平台以及您正在使用哪个同步提供程序。
如果您正在使用SqlCeSyncProvider / SqlSyncProvider,则可以设置基于内存的批处理,同样,您也可以设置SQL命令超时。